Where to Use and Where to Exercise Caution
Not every design asset is right for every situation. While the Colorful Christmas Nutcracker PNG is versatile, there are specific scenarios where it works best and others where it might detract from your goals.
Optimal Use Cases:
- Seasonal Packaging Accents: Use it to break up solid colors on boxes or bags during the holiday season.
- Boutique Visuals: Ideal for window displays, storefront signage, and in-store promotional posters.
- Product Mockups: Overlay this asset onto mockups of mugs, t-shirts, or tote bags to visualize your product line before production.
- Digital Campaigns: Perfect for email headers, website banners, and social media cover images.
Areas Requiring Careful Consideration:
- Formal Corporate Branding: If your business operates in a strict B2B environment or offers legal/financial services, this playful tone may be too informal.
- Very Small Labels: On tiny product labels, intricate details in the illustration may blur or become indistinguishable. Always test at actual size.
- Crowded Layouts: Avoid placing this asset next to dense blocks of text or complex patterns. It needs breathing room to be effective.
- Luxury Minimalist Brands: If your brand aesthetic relies on stark minimalism and muted tones, a colorful, detailed nutcracker might clash with your established visual language.
Practical Designer Notes for Implementation
Before you integrate this asset into your final designs, follow these practical steps to ensure quality and compliance:
Technical Verification: First, inspect the PNG transparency. Ensure the edges are clean and free of halos, especially if you plan to place it on dark or patterned backgrounds. If possible, check if an SVG version is available for better scalability. Vector formats allow you to resize the asset without losing quality, which is crucial for large-format printing like banners or vehicle wraps.
Typography Pairing: Test the illustration alongside different font styles. A script font can enhance the whimsical nature of the nutcracker, while a bold sans-serif font can ground it for a more modern look. Avoid pairing it with overly ornate serif fonts unless you are aiming for a very specific vintage aesthetic. The goal is harmony, not competition.
Color Adaptation: Preview the asset with your brand colors. Does the nutcracker’s palette complement your existing scheme, or does it clash? You may need to adjust the hue or saturation slightly to ensure it feels like part of your unified brand identity rather than an imported element.
Legal Compliance: Most importantly, confirm the commercial license. Just because you found it on a creative marketplace does not mean you can use it for unlimited physical product sales. Review the terms regarding commercial design usage. Ensure you have the right to use the asset for product labels, marketing materials, and potentially merchandise. Failure to secure proper licensing can lead to costly legal issues down the line.
